Board approves contractor change order and signs short-term roller agreement for road work

The board approved a change order for a communications/phone project with TCS and agreed to finalize a short‑term roller rental agreement to assist with gravel placement and compaction on county roads.
Commissioners voted to approve the TCS change order after staff explained it covered additional work and engineering revisions. A motion to approve the change order passed by voice vote. Separately, staff discussed a offered roller/compaction service and its quoted price; county staff noted the quote was for 176 hours (four weeks) at a cost of $6,800 and confirmed insurance coverage before signing. Commissioners indicated they would sign the agreement and arrange insurance/notarization.
No additional funding appropriation was made beyond the authorization to approve the change order and execute the rental agreement; staff said the roller hours may be budgeted into next year's plan if needed. The actions were operational and administrative in nature: the board approved the contractor change order and authorized staff to finalize the roller contract with required signatures and insurance.
